What Is Dimming?

Dimming is through the dimmer to adjust luminous flux and illuminating level in the lighting device. Nowadays, there are many dimming drivers for different dimming ways used, such like the Triac dimmer, LED 0/1-10v dimmer, and PWM dimmer. All of their dimming methods is though controlling the output of current, voltage, and frequency magnitude to adjust the brightness. In the following. We will show how they operate by using the method.

LED 0/1-10v Dimming

0-10v dimming also called 0-10v signal dimming, is an analog dimming method that adds two port of +10v and - 10v on the driver differ from the Triac dimmer. It makes a dimming purpose via adjusting 1-10v voltage to control the current output from the driver. 0V is off, and 10v is the most brightness. When the resistance dimmer is set to a minimum of 1V, the output current is 10%, and if the output current is 100% at 10V, the brightness will also be 100. It is worth noting and best distinguished, 1-10V does not have an on/off function and cannot turn the luminaire to its minimum off function, whereas 0-10V has an on/off function. 1-10V does not have an on/off function and cannot turn the luminaire to its minimum off function, whereas 0-10V has an on/off function.

Triac Dimming

Triac dimming has been used in incandescent lamps and energy-saving lamps for a long time, at present, it is also the most widely used dimming method for LED dimming. Triac dimming is a physical dimming, starting from AC phase 0, the input voltage is chopped, and there is no voltage input until the Triac driver is turned on. Its working principle is to generate a tangential output voltage waveform after the input voltage waveform is cut through the conduction angle. By applying the principle of tangential direction, the effective value of the output voltage can be reduced, thereby reducing the power of the common load (resistive load). The Triac dimmer has the advantages of high adjustment accuracy, high efficiency, small size, lightweight, and easy long-distance manipulation, and is dominant in the market. The advantages of Triac dimming are high working efficiency, stable performance, and low dimming cost.

PWM Dimming

Pulse-width modulation (PWM) is a very effective technique for controlling analog circuits using the digital output of a microprocessor, and is widely used in many fields, from measurement and communications to power control and conversion and LED lighting. By controlling analog circuits digitally, the cost and power consumption of the system can be greatly reduced. In addition, many micro-controllers and DSPs already include a PWM controller on-chip, which makes digital control easier to implement.

Simply put, PWM is a method of digitally encoding the level of an analog signal. Through the use of high-resolution counters, the duty cycle of the square wave is modulated to encode the level of a specific analog signal. The PWM signal is still digital because at any given moment, the full-scale DC supply is either completely present or completely absent. A voltage or current source is applied to the analog load in a repetitive sequence of on or off pulses. When it is on, it is when the DC power supply is added to the load, and when it is off, it is when the power supply is disconnected.

How To Choose The Best One For Your Place?

Before choosing the LDE driver, we should clearly recognize the ways of  wired dimming and wireless dimming. There are five wired dimming way include Traic Dimming, 0/1-10v dimming, DALI dimming, PWM dimming and DMX dimming. And there are four wireless dimming ways include Bluetooth, WIFI, Zigbee, and Z-wave.
